/// <summary> /// Actual executable method of database query which returns data from database. /// </summary> /// <param name="session">The database connection session.</param> /// <param name="cancellationToken">Operation cancellation token.</param> public virtual async Task <IEnumerable <T> > ExecuteAsync(IDatabaseSession session, CancellationToken cancellationToken) => await session.QueryAsync <T>(this.SqlStatement, this.Parameters, cancellationToken);